ZoomX foam plus a carbon-fibre plate equals an energised ride.

The Zoom Fly 6 is with you every step of your run. Lighter than the Zoom Fly 5, its responsive ZoomX foam adds energy return to each stride, while a carbon-fibre plate helps propel you to the finishing line of the ekiden.

Responsive speed

ZoomX foam, Nike's lightest and most responsive foam, delivers our most energy return with every stride you take.

Carbon-fibre plate

The full-length carbon-fibre plate increases efficiency and responsiveness.

Grippy outsole

The thin rubber outsole is lightweight and grippy on the road.

Product details

  • Weight: 265g approx. (men's size 9)
  • Heel-to-toe drop: 8mm
  • Synthetic leather on upper
  • Reflective design details
